The Hiroshima University International Center organizes the fifth and sixth International Exchanges of the Region and the University-Program “Let’s Exchange with Oasa Third Year Junior High School Students; Part 5-6!”



In the 2011 academic year, the International Center of Hiroshima University held 4 exchange programs with Oasa junior high school students, international students, and Japanese students from Hiroshima University. It was part of the 2011 Hiroshima University and Society Collaboration Project B-8 “Exchange Project between Junior High School Students in Oasa and Hiroshima University International and Japanese Students”. From there, exchange has continued and this academic year HU has already held two events.



At the first “Let’s Exchange with Oasa Third Year Junior High School Students; Part 5” on July 11 (Wed), 17 junior high school students from Oasa Junior High School visited Hiroshima University. In the morning, they listened to a mini-lecture by Institute of Engineering Professor Toru Yamamoto. After having lunch in the university cafeteria, they gave a well-rehearsed report on the culture of Oasa to the (2 international and 3 Japanese) students. Then they went on the Campus Tour together with international students.



The second event was held on November 15 (Thu); “Let’s Exchange with Oasa Third Year Junior High School Students; Part 6 ~English Lesson and Cultural Exchange~”. 4 international and 4 Japanese students from Hiroshima University visited Oasa Junior High School. The opening ceremony was held in the morning, and then the students took part in first and second grade English lessons and enjoyed getting to know each other by answering students’ questions and introducing themselves in English. After lunch, they participated in the third year students’ English class with English conversation and games together. The international students who visited a Japanese junior high school for the first time said that they were impressed how hard the junior high students try to speak in English even though they are very shy, and that it was admirable that they had their own opinions.

We hope that this exchange program will help Oasa students understand various values, and be more positive about communication by having contact with foreign cultures. It is our wish that the international students of our university will be able to learn about things like Japanese culture and the environment, which is difficult to teach only in the university classroom, by experiencing cultural exchange with junior high school students and the local population.
